How to turn off your iphone 11 when it’s frozen?

You asked, Why is my iPhone 11 frozen and wont turn off? If the device is unresponsive, Press and quickly release the Volume up button then press and quickly release the Volume down button. To complete, press and hold the Side button until the Apple logo appears on the screen. Allow several seconds for the reboot process to complete.

How do you fix a frozen iPhone 11?

  1. Step 1 How to Force Restart an iPhone 11. Quickly press and release the Volume Up button (1). Quickly press and release the Volume Down button (2).
  2. Finally, press and hold the side button (3) until the Apple logo appears, and then release. The screen will temporarily go dark as the iPhone shuts down and reboots.

Why is iPhone 12 frozen?

A majority of the time that an iPhone freezes, the problem’s caused by a software malfunction. Usually, a hard reset will temporarily unfreeze your iPhone 12. However, hard resetting your iPhone doesn’t fix the issue that made it freeze.

Why is my phone stuck on the Apple screen?

Software issues are probably the most common reason for your iPhone being stuck on the Apple logo. Nine times out of ten, software issues are caused by either a failed software update, using an older version of the Apple iOS or having a jailbroken iPhone.
